[OE-core] [PATCH v3 3/3] import: new plugin to import the devtool workspace

Takes a tar archive created by 'devtool export' and export it (untar) to
workspace. By default, the whole tar archive is imported, thus there is no
way to limit what is imported.

+"""Devtool import plugin"""
+
+import os
+import tarfile
+import logging
+import re
+import json
+import fnmatch
+
+from devtool import standard, setup_tinfoil, replace_from_file
+from devtool import export
+
+logger = logging.getLogger('devtool')
+
+def devimport(args, config, basepath, workspace):
+    """Entry point for the devtool 'import' subcommand"""
+
+    if not os.path.exists(args.file):
+        logger.error('Tar archive %s does not exist. Export your workspace using "devtool export"')
+        return 1
+
+
+    tinfoil = setup_tinfoil(config_only=False, basepath=basepath)
+
+    imported = []
+    tar = tarfile.open(args.file)
+    members = tar.getmembers()
+
+    # get exported metadata so values containing paths can be automatically replaced it
+    export_workspace_path = export_workspace = None
+    try:
+        metadata = tar.getmember(export.metadata)
+        tar.extract(metadata)
+        with open(metadata.name) as fdm:
+            export_workspace_path, export_workspace = json.load(fdm)
+        os.unlink(metadata.name)
+    except KeyError as ke:
+        logger.error('The export metadata file created by "devtool export" was not found')
+        return 1
+
+    try:
+        recipe_files = [os.path.basename(recipe[0]) for recipe in tinfoil.cooker.recipecaches[''].pkg_fn.items()]
+    finally:
+        if tinfoil:
+            tinfoil.shutdown()
+
+    for member in members:
+        # do not export the metadata
+        if member.name == export.metadata:
+            continue
+
+        is_bbappend = False
+
+        # check bbappend has its corresponding recipe, if not warn continue with next tar member
+        if member.name.startswith('appends'):
+            is_bbappend = True
+            append_root,_ = os.path.splitext(os.path.basename(member.name))
+
+            # check on new recipes introduced by the export
+            for exported_recipe in export_workspace.keys():
+                if append_root.startswith(exported_recipe):
+                    break
+            else:
+                # check on current recipes
+                for recipe_file in recipe_files:
+                    if fnmatch.fnmatch(recipe_file, append_root.replace('%', '') + '*'):
+                        break
+                else:
+                    logger.warn('No recipe to append %s, skipping' % append_root)
+                    continue
+
+        # extract
+        path = os.path.join(config.workspace_path, member.name)
+        if os.path.exists(path):
+            # by default, no file overwrite is done unless -o is given by the user
+            if args.overwrite:
+                try:
+                    tar.extract(member, path=config.workspace_path)
+                except PermissionError as pe:
+                    logger.warn(pe)
+            else:
+                logger.warn('File already present. Use --overwrite/-o to overwrite it: %s' % member.name)
+                continue
+        else:
+            tar.extract(member, path=config.workspace_path)
+
+        # bbappend require extra handling
+        if is_bbappend:
+
+            # we need to get the exported PN from the exported metadata,
+            for exported_recipe in export_workspace.keys():
+                if exported_recipe in member.name:
+                    pn = exported_recipe
+                    break
+            else:
+                logger.error('Exported metadata does not correspond to data')
+
+            # Update EXTERNALSRC
+            if export_workspace_path:
+                # appends created by 'devtool modify' just need to update the workspace
+                replace_from_file(path, export_workspace_path, config.workspace_path)
+
+                # appends created by 'devtool add' need replacement of exported source tree
+                exported_srctree = export_workspace[pn]['srctree']
+                if exported_srctree:
+                    replace_from_file(path, exported_srctree, os.path.join(config.workspace_path, 'sources', pn))
+
+            # update .devtool_md5 file
+            standard._add_md5(config, pn, path)
+            if pn not in imported:
+                imported.append(pn)
+
+    tar.close()
+
+    logger.info('Imported recipes into workspace %s: %s' % (config.workspace_path, ' '.join(imported)))
+    return 0
+
+def register_commands(subparsers, context):
+    """Register devtool import subcommands"""
+    parser = subparsers.add_parser('import',
+                                   help='Import exported tar archive into workspace',
+                                   description='Import tar archive previously created by "devtool export" into workspace',
+                                   group='advanced')
+    parser.add_argument('file', metavar='FILE', help='Name of the tar archive to import')
+    parser.add_argument('--overwrite', '-o', action="store_true", help='Overwrite files when extracting')
+    parser.set_defaults(func=devimport)
